Casting At An Opponent!!
I was reading one of the articles on this site about tournament etiquette and the author said if he feels someone is coming too close to his spot he'll chuck his carolina rig at them, not hitting the boat but close enough to let them get the hint or even cross their lines. Is this really acceptable? Do a lot of you do this? Also say I want to flip a row of docks and there's already someone hitting them goin the same direction as me. Is it acceptable to cut in front of him as long as I give them a few docks as a buffer? and if so how much space is a sportsmanlike distance?

Flw Bfl
I'm trying to fish some BFL's as a co angler this year too. I don't have much previous tournament experience but I figured this would be the best way to learn. I was going to bring five rods too but I was told that if you talk to your boater before you go out he can pretty much narrow down what you need and you can usually get away with 4 rods and a 3 or 4 trays worth of stuff. The hardest part for me is going to be choosing what to leave behind, I have separation issues. lol
